在close事件中调用:
application.Terminate;

解决方案 »

  1.   

    application.exit()是什么意思呢?
      

  2.   

    application.exit()是一种正常退出程序的手段。注意,Close事件的2个参数中的那个System.ComponentModel.CancelEventArgs e参数,e有个cancel属性,如果为true的话程序就不退出了,false的话就应该正常退出
      

  3.   

    在main函数中的有application.run(new form1),是运行程序,所以推出应该是application.exit()
      

  4.   

    好像application.exit()也无法完全退出
    你试试这样:
    Process.GetCurrentProcess().kill();
      

  5.   


     如下:private void Form2_Closing(object sender, System.ComponentModel.CancelEventArgs e)
    {
    Application.Exit();
    } :)
      

  6.   

    我也碰到appliction.Exit()不能退出的问题,可以用
    System.Environment.Exit(1);这样就可以退出整个环境了!
      

  7.   

    //晕,我都不会出现阿!
    System.Environment.Exit(1); //看看